New images of Baby Shard released
Shard of Glass developer Sellar Property Group has unveiled new images of the office block which will neighbour Renzo Piano’s 310m-high skyscraper.Sometimes known as the “Baby Shard”, the 17-storey tower, officially called The Place, has also been designed by Piano and is part of the wider £2 billion London Bridge ...

Nord selected for Glasgow hospice
Nord has been appointed to design a new facility for the Prince & Princess of Wales Hospice in Glasgow.The building, due to be completed in 2016, will provide palliative care facilities for adults and young people.Nord director Alan Pert, who earlier this year split from practice co-founder Robin Lee after ...

News
Avanti's £18m health centre opens in Barrhead
An £18 million health centre in Barrhead designed by Avanti Architects for NHS Greater Glasgow & Clyde Health Board and East Renfrewshire Council has opened.The building contains three GP practices, a clinical zone, two dental practices, adult mental-health services, a podiatry and physiotherapy department, an elderly day care centre and ...
